A nurse is caring for a diabetic client with a preoperative blood glucose of 200 mg/dL scheduled for major abdominal surgery in the morning. Which nursing action should be the highest priority during the preoperative period?

해설
Highest priority is monitoring blood glucose every 2-4 hours to maintain euglycemia, as hyperglycemia increases surgical risks like infection and poor wound healing. Other actions are important but secondary: NPO status is standard, insulin may need adjustment, and lab verification does not address immediate glucose control.

Core Nursing Explanation This question tests the nurse's ability to prioritize care for a diabetic patient in the preoperative period. The core concept is managing perioperative hyperglycemia, a significant risk factor for surgical complications. Key Concept Analysis The patient has Diabetes Mellitus (DM) and an elevated preoperative blood glucose of 200 mg/dL. This indicates hyperglycemia, which is a critical concern before surgery. Uncontrolled hyperglycemia impairs immune function, increases the risk of surgical site infections (SSI), delays wound healing, and can lead to metabolic disturbances like diabetic ketoacidosis (DKA) or hyperosmolar hyperglycemic state (HHS). The primary goal is to achieve and maintain euglycemia (normal blood glucose range) to minimize these risks. Answer Rationale Key Point! The highest priority action is Monitor blood glucose levels every 2-4 hours and maintain euglycemia. This is a direct, ongoing, and active intervention to manage the patient's most immediate and modifiable risk factor. Frequent monitoring allows for timely interventions (e.g., sliding scale insulin) to correct hyperglycemia before it causes harm. This action embodies the nursing principles of assessment and intervention to ensure patient safety. Distractor Analysis Watch out for confusion! While the other actions are part of standard preoperative care, they are not the highest priority for this specific patient scenario.
② Ensure NPO status: This is a standard preoperative order to prevent aspiration. However, it is a routine protocol and does not specifically address the identified problem of hyperglycemia. For a diabetic patient, prolonged NPO status itself can create a risk for hypoglycemia, which also needs monitoring.
③ Administer regular morning insulin: This could be dangerous. If the patient is NPO and not eating, administering their usual dose of intermediate or long-acting insulin could cause severe hypoglycemia during surgery. Insulin regimens are typically adjusted on the day of surgery (e.g., holding or giving a reduced dose), based on specific physician orders and blood glucose levels.
④ Verify lab results: This is an important safety check, but it is an administrative/verification task. It does not constitute an active intervention to correct the existing hyperglycemia. The abnormal glucose level is already known. Related Concepts Perioperative diabetes management often involves a variable rate intravenous insulin infusion (VRIII) or "insulin drip" for major surgeries to provide tight glycemic control. The target blood glucose range during the perioperative period is typically 140-180 mg/dL. Understanding the difference between managing hyperglycemia risk versus hypoglycemia risk is crucial. Anatomy, Physiology & Pharmacology Points Pathophysiology: Hyperglycemia creates an osmotic diuresis, leads to dehydration, and impairs neutrophil function (white blood cells), reducing the body's ability to fight infection at the surgical site.
Pharmacology: Know the onset, peak, and duration of the patient's insulin type (e.g., rapid-acting, long-acting). Sliding scale insulin (SSI) is commonly used for correction doses based on frequent blood glucose checks. Memory Tips ABCs + Glucose: In many priority questions, think Airway, Breathing, Circulation. For a diabetic patient, add "Glucose" to your immediate assessment priorities, especially in the perioperative setting.

Nursing Clinical Practice Guide Clinical Scenario: You are the pre-op nurse for Mr. Jones, a 58-year-old with Type 2 DM, scheduled for a colectomy. His 6 AM fingerstick blood glucose is 210 mg/dL. He has been NPO since midnight and is anxious. Nursing Intervention Strategy 1. Assessment: Immediately document the elevated glucose. Assess for signs of hyperglycemia (polyuria, polydipsia, blurred vision) or dehydration (dry mucous membranes, poor skin turgor). Check his most recent HbA1c if available. 2. Planning & Implementation: Initiate frequent glucose monitoring (every 2 hours). Follow the institution's preoperative diabetes protocol, which likely involves notifying the surgeon/anesthesiologist. They may order a variable rate intravenous insulin infusion (VRIII) to start in pre-op or hold oral medications/adjust subcutaneous insulin. 3. Patient Education: Explain to Mr. Jones why his blood sugar is being checked so often and that controlling it is key to preventing infection after surgery. 4. Evaluation: The goal is to have his blood glucose within the target range (140-180 mg/dL) before entering the operating room. Patient Safety and Precautions * Key Point! Hypoglycemia is a greater immediate danger than hyperglycemia in an NPO/sedated patient. Always have a source of rapid-acting glucose (e.g., D50W IV, oral glucose gel) readily available. * Never assume an insulin order is correct for an NPO patient. Always verify with the protocol or prescriber. * Communicate the patient's glucose trends and insulin requirements clearly during handoff to the OR and PACU (Post-Anesthesia Care Unit) nurses. Nursing Procedure & Medication Flow Blood Glucose Monitoring (Pre-Op): 1. Perform hand hygiene and don gloves. 2. Use a lancet to obtain a capillary blood sample from the side of the fingertip. 3. Apply blood to the test strip in the glucometer. 4. Document the result, time, and any related interventions (e.g., "BG 210 mg/dL, surgeon notified, order received for 2-unit correction dose of rapid-acting insulin").
Insulin Administration (Pre-Op - if ordered): 1. Double-check the order against the protocol for NPO patients. 2. Use only rapid-acting insulin (e.g., aspart, lispro) for correction doses, as its short duration minimizes post-operative hypoglycemia risk. 3. Administer subcutaneously, and ensure the patient has a meal tray ordered for post-op arrival to the PACU to prevent hypoglycemia.
